The Branson Police Department arrested six people and discovered drugs and money counterfeiting operations while serving a search warrant on multiple rooms at the Metropolitan Motel on Sunday morning around 5:30.

Branson Police developed information from proactive enforcement efforts that led to this search warrant. The Branson Police Department, along with the Taney County Sheriff’s Department Special Operations Team, served the search warrant. A wide assortment of drugs and firearms were seized along with evidence of a counterfeiting operation. The Secret Service, Alcohol Tobacco and Firearms and Branson Police are assisting with this investigation.

Six people, including a member of the motel management, were arrested on a variety of charges and transported to the Taney County jail. Branson Police are communicating with the Taney County Prosecuting Attorney’s Office and Missouri Probation and Parole on the charges.

This investigation aligns with the city’s efforts to hold motel management accountable for safe lodging. As a result of this investigation, a comprehensive review of the motel’s business license and inspection records is being conducted.
